Reasonable maintenance of boxwoodReasonable maintenance is not only for winter, but also for the whole year. Only reasonable irrigation and fertilization can enhance the resistance of boxwood itself. This is the most basic rule for wintering. Setting up wind barriers for boxwoodThe wind in winter is very cold. Setting up wind barriers on the outside of the boxwood can not only prevent the wind, but also have a certain warming effect. Boxwood trunk treatmentThere is no need to say much about tree trunk treatment. Whether it is boxwood or other plants, the most commonly used wintering method is to whitewash the trunk or wrap the trunk. Wintering with Boxwood Base CoveringThis method is generally used in boxwood forests or boxwood bases, covering the ground with horse manure, plastic film or hay to help them overwinter. Wintering with Fumigation Method in Boxwood BaseIt is also suitable for large boxwood forests or boxwood bases. On winter nights, we light haystacks next to the boxwood forest and use the smoke to keep the boxwood warm and moist. Although this method is simple and feasible, it is quite risky. In winter when the weather is dry, it is easy to cause a fire, so you must pay attention to safety when fumigating. |
